很多小伙伴在学习python代码编写规则时可能会看到Pythonic这个词语,也有人会说符合Pythonic风格的python代码才是好的代码。那下面这篇文章就会来介绍一下Pythonic是什么,以及如何去编写一个符合Pythonic风格的函数,往下看看吧。
一、Pythonic是什么
Pythonic就是python风格的意思,简单来说就是你编写的python代码需要尽量的去符合python的规则以及PEP 8所设立的规范。因为这样子编写出来的python代码简洁、优雅、清晰的,能够很容易的就被其他的开发给理解和看懂。
二、如何编写Pythonic风格的函数
Python之中函数是一个使用非常广泛一个语法,那么想要去编写一个符合Pythonic风格的函数需要遵守一定的规则才可以。
(1)命名:一个函数的开始就是从命名来的,函数的命名需要描述这个函数所实现的是什么功能,还有需要符合驼峰命名法或使用下划线去连接。例如一个函数需要去获取班级里每个孩子的成绩就可以写成get_Score,这样子简洁清晰而又意思明了。
(2)单一功能原则:一个函数需要遵守单一功能原则,也就是说这个函数只需要实现一个功能,提供单个或少量的返回值就可以了。这样既方便函数的更新和修改,在使用起来也不用去考虑它是否还有其他的用处而难以辨别。
(3)函数长度:一个符合Pythonic风格的函数长度最好在五十行以内,因为过长的函数长度会影响可读性和可维护型。
以上就是如何去编写一个符合Pythonic风格的python函数所需要遵守的规则了。